Rose McDonald 1886–1960 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 1886
Birth Location: Longwarry, Victoria, Australia
Death Date: Abt 1960
Death Location: Cheltenham, City of Bayside, Victoria, Australia
Father: James McDonald
Mother: Rose Boyd
Spouse(s): Alexander Young
Children(s): Hugh Young
The story of Rose McDonald began in 1886 in Longwarry, Victoria, Australia. Rose McDonald married Alexander John Jack Young, and had children including Hugh Alexander Young. Rose McDonald passed away in 1960 in Cheltenham, City of Bayside, Victoria, Australia.
